WebbThe countries with low growth rates are those that built their scientific capacity decades ago and continue to maintain their scientific research. The worldwide growth of publication output, from 1.9 million in 2010 to 2.9 million in 2024, was led by four geographically large countries. China (36%), India (9%), Russia (6%), and the United ...
